Okra Stew (Mâfe Takou)

Cultural Context

Originating from Senegal, Mâfe Takou is a beloved dish that showcases the rich flavors and ingredients of West African cuisine. This hearty stew combines okra with peanut butter, creating a unique blend of textures and tastes that reflect the local agricultural bounty. Traditionally served with rice, it is a staple in many Senegalese households, often enjoyed during family gatherings and celebrations. Today, variations of this dish can be found across West Africa and beyond, each with its own twist on the classic recipe.

1

Heat palm oil in a large pot over medium heat until shimmering.

2

Add chopped onion and sauté until translucent, about 5-7 minutes.

3

Stir in diced bell pepper and cook until fragrant, about 1 minute.

4

Add fresh and dried fish and crayfish; cook until softened, about 5 minutes.

5

Mix in curry powder and stir until well combined with the fish mixture.

6

Pour in vegetable broth and bring to a simmer.

7

Add sliced okra; stir well.

8

Season with salt to taste.

9

Add bay leaves and reduce heat to low; cover and simmer for 20-25 minutes.

10

Stir occasionally to prevent sticking, adding water if necessary.

11

Finish with lime juice and chopped cilantro before serving.

12

Serve hot.
